MCoBeauty’s All Dayer Long Lasting Makeup Setting Spray is a new launch that revives a fine mist formula many beauty lovers already know and love for delivering a 16-hour hold and a patented cooling sensation.
Skindinavia had a long-standing product development partnership with a cosmetics brand, but it ended a year ago, when Skindinavia’s partner relaunched its hero setting spray with an in-house formula. Now, MCoBeauty has teamed up with Skindinavia to revive the original setting spray with a fresh name and packaging design that offers a cheeky nod to the OG cult product.
MCoBeauty is known for offering affordable drugstore dupes to luxury brand products, but on MCoBeauty’s Instagram post announcing this major beauty news, Skindinavia commented: “This is no dupe. This is the original best seller. It belongs to the makeup artists and beauty lovers who have used it for years.”
